toll rds
 
we will be driving from albany n.y.through vermont,new hampshire and maine....my concern is that there may be cash-less tolls?

J62 Apr 5th, 2019 09:07 AM

From Albany to VT to NH there are no tolls. The only toll road in the Albany area is the NYS thruway (which is I-90 west of the city (thruway exit 24) , and I87 to the south (from thruway exit 23), and the NYS thruway does have ticket/cash lanes.

But you would not be getting on the NY thruway anywhere in / near albany to get to VT regardless of which way you go. (East through Troy to Bennington, heading north in NY, no toll roads.
.
I think that's also true for Maine - there are (iirc) cash/attended lanes at the few tolls on I95. The Mass Pike (I90) is cashless, but they have a plate reader system that I believe you can go online and register your license plate. If it's a rental car, not exactly sure the best way to do that.

We just drove on I95 in Maine about a week ago. There are still cash lanes. I think the only toll roads in NH are north/south routes: Everett Turnpike from Nashua to Manchester, I93, and I95.
